I think that is the unit I bought at Wal-Mart a few months ago for about $40; grey in color, with a strange four-sided key. It's definitely a Sentry and the size sounds right. I bolted it solidly to a bureau and use it for securing carry guns when I don't want to open and close the big safe downstairs all the time. It's a lot better unit that the ones in use in many jails and prisons--which is a little scary...

I thought it was a pretty heavy duty unit for the money. Someone would have to work pretty darned hard to get it open. If I expect to be gone overnight or for any length of time the guns go in the big safe, though.

I would recommend it if you don't mind having to use a key everytime.
